# MCP Server Wrapper
A meta-MCP server that dynamically invokes any MCP server without restarting Claude Code. Add, remove, and invoke MCP servers on-the-fly.
## Features
- **Dynamic Server Management**: Add/remove MCP servers at runtime
- **Multiple Transports**: Support for stdio, SSE, and HTTP streaming
- **Persistent Configuration**: Server configs saved to disk
- **Connection Pooling**: Efficient connection reuse
- **Zero Restart**: No need to restart Claude Code when adding new MCPs

## Tools
### `mcp_list_servers`
List all registered MCP servers and their connection status.
### `mcp_add_server`
Add a new MCP server configuration.
**Parameters:**
- `id` (required): Unique identifier
- `name` (required): Human-readable name
- `transport` (required): `stdio`, `sse`, or `http-stream`
- `command`: Command for stdio transport
- `args`: Command arguments for stdio
- `url`: URL for SSE/HTTP transport
- `env`: Environment variables
- `headers`: HTTP headers
- `enabled`: Enable/disable server
- `persist`: Save to config file (default: true)
**Example - stdio:**
```json
{
"id": "context7",
"name": "Context7",
"transport": "stdio",
"command": "npx",
"args": ["-y", "@upstash/context7-mcp@latest"]
}
```
**Example - HTTP stream:**
```json
{
"id": "deepwiki",
"name": "Deepwiki",
"transport": "http-stream",
"url": "https://mcp.deepwiki.com/mcp"
}
```
### `mcp_remove_server`
Remove an MCP server configuration.
**Parameters:**
- `server` (required): Server ID to remove
- `persist`: Remove from config file (default: true)
### `mcp_list_tools`
List available tools from an MCP server.
**Parameters:**
- `server`: Server ID (lists all if not specified)
- `pattern`: Filter tools by name pattern
### `mcp_invoke`
Invoke any tool from any registered MCP server.
**Parameters:**
- `server` (required): Server ID
- `tool` (required): Tool name
- `arguments`: Tool arguments
- `timeout`: Timeout in milliseconds
## Usage Examples
### Add and use Context7
```
1. mcp_add_server: id=context7, transport=stdio, command=npx, args=["-y", "@upstash/context7-mcp@latest"]
2. mcp_list_tools: server=context7
3. mcp_invoke: server=context7, tool=resolve-library-id, arguments={libraryName: "react"}
```
### Add and use Deepwiki
```
1. mcp_add_server: id=deepwiki, transport=http-stream, url=https://mcp.deepwiki.com/mcp
2. mcp_invoke: server=deepwiki, tool=ask_question, arguments={repoName: "facebook/react", question: "What is useEffect?"}
```
## Supported Transports
| Transport | Description | Use Case |
|-----------|-------------|----------|
| `stdio` | Standard I/O | Local MCP servers (npx, uvx) |
| `sse` | Server-Sent Events | Legacy remote servers |
| `http-stream` | HTTP Streaming | Modern remote servers |
## Configuration File
Server configurations are persisted to:
- **Windows**: `%USERPROFILE%\Documents\Project\MCP\mcp-wrapper\config\servers.json`
- **macOS/Linux**: `~/Documents/Project/MCP/mcp-wrapper/config/servers.json`
